Publication number: 20090106568Abstract: A client-host detection device for detecting connecting a connected peripheral is disclosed herein. The device comprises a peripheral sensor connected to a terminal, a terminal sensor connected to or for connection to a peripheral and a terminal electrical connector connected to the terminal for electrical connection with a peripheral electrical connector connected to a peripheral. The peripheral sensor is positioned to sense the terminal sensor upon connection of the terminal electrical connector with the peripheral electrical connector. The device allows for an electrical connector to be maintained in an unpowered state unless a peripheral is connected thereby reducing or preventing de-plating of the contacts of the electrical connector caused by conductive solution across the contacts as a result of the voltage on the connections. The device also allows for the use of an unpowered peripheral.Type: ApplicationFiled: October 22, 2008Publication date: April 23, 2009Applicant: PSION TEKLOGIX INC.Inventor: NIC JAMES

Publication number: 20090021374Abstract: A method and system for power control for Radio Frequency Identification (RFID) tag reading is provided. The system includes a power amplifier for providing an RF transmit signal for the RFID tag reading. The RF transmit signal is provided to an antenna for radiating the transmit signal. The power of the radiated transmit signal defining a read range for the RFID tag reading. The system includes an attenuator provided between the power amplifier and the antenna for controlling the power of the radiated transmit signal to adjust the read range. A handheld RFID reader may include the system. The method includes calibrating the output power of a reader having a power amplifier and an attenuator provided between the power amplifier and an antenna. The step of calibrating includes at least one of controlling power of the power amplifier in its linear region, and controlling attenuation level of the attenuator.Type: ApplicationFiled: July 17, 2007Publication date: January 22, 2009Applicant: PSION TEKLOGIX INC.Inventor: Adrian Joseph Stagg

Patent number: 7307645Abstract: A control circuit to vary the intensity of an electro luminescent display. The circuit is connected between a power source and a display and comprises a pair of conductors to be connected to the display for applying a voltage from a voltage generator. A switch controls application of the voltage from the generator to the conductors. A gating circuit connects selectively one or other of the conductors to the voltage source. A controller operates upon the switch to vary the duty cycle and upon the gating circuit to alternate periodically the relative polarity of the conductors. The voltage source includes an inductor and the switch controls current flow through said inductor.Type: GrantFiled: July 22, 2004Date of Patent: December 11, 2007Assignee: Psion Teklogix Inc.Inventor: Lawrence D. Forsythe

Patent number: 7099295Abstract: A bridge apparatus is provided for interfacing or bridging between a wired network having wired communication devices and wireless devices. The bridge apparatus of the present invention is typically used in a warehouse inventory control system. In one embodiment, the bridge apparatus includes two more radios having different modalities in order to provide different modality and/or types of coverage to different wireless devices. In another embodiment, a single bridge apparatus offers different coverage areas. The bridge apparatus has a filter device for filtering data received from the wired network, and forwards the filtered data to a wireless device. Thus, data can be forwarded to the wireless devices from the wired network without a need for protocol conversion. In another embodiment, a bridge apparatus functions both as an access point to filter data received from the wired network, and as a base station to convert protocol information included in data received from the wired network.Type: GrantFiled: August 27, 1999Date of Patent: August 29, 2006Assignee: Psion Teklogix, Inc.Inventors: Michael Anthony Doyle, Joseph Harold Buccino, Robert Philip Vandervecht

Patent number: 7059530Abstract: The invention relates to a window for an optical scanning device having a panel having a pair of oppositely directed light transmitting surfaces. A heater wire of a diameter less than the width of the smallest permissible indicia of a barcode is embedded between the first and second light transmitting surfaces. The heater wire being entirely contained within the perimeter of the optical scanning device window except for a length of both of its extremities.Type: GrantFiled: April 24, 2003Date of Patent: June 13, 2006Assignee: Psion Teklogix,Inc.Inventors: Andre Joseph Claude Gagne, Daniel Joseph Meringer

Patent number: 6922557Abstract: A wireless network communication system consists of an access server for facilitating communication between a network resource interfacing with the access server over a land-based network and a wireless communications device interfacing with the access server over a wireless network. A message intended for transmission from the wireless communication device to the network resource is transmitted to the access server over a wireless network as a number of message datagrams. Upon receipt of the message datagrams over the wireless network, the access server generates and transmits to the wireless communication device an acknowledgement datagram indicating successful receipt of each message datagram, and transmits the successfully received message datagrams to the network resource over the land-based network.Type: GrantFiled: December 3, 2001Date of Patent: July 26, 2005Assignee: Psion Teklogix Inc.Inventor: Steve Fantaske
